hu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L分布式架构的优势与实践|mysql分布式查询,MySQL分布式

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文探讨了Linux操作系统下MySQL分布式架构的优势与实践,重点分析了MySQL分布式查询的实现方法。通过分布式架构,MySQL能够提高数据处理效率、增强系统可扩展性和高可用性。实践中,分布式查询优化了数据访问,提升了多节点间的数据同步性能。

本文目录导读:

  1. MySQL分布式架构的优势
  2. MySQL分布式架构的实践

随着互联网业务的快速发展,数据量的激增成为企业面临的重大挑战,如何高效地管理和处理海量数据,成为众多企业关注的焦点,MySQL分布式架构作为种解决方案,因其高可用性、高性能和可扩展性等特点,得到了广泛应用,本文将探讨MySQL分布式架构的优势及其在实际应用中的实践。

MySQL分布式架构的优势

1、高可用性

MySQL分布式架构通过多节点部署,实现了数据冗余和负载均衡,当某个节点发生故障时,其他节点可以自动接管其工作,确保整个系统的高可用性,分布式架构还可以实现故障自动切换和故障恢复,提高系统的稳定性。

2、高性能

分布式架构可以将数据分散存储在多个节点上,通过并行处理提高数据处理速度,分布式数据库管理系统(DBMS)可以自动进行数据分片和负载均衡,使得系统具备更高的性能。

3、可扩展性

MySQL分布式架构支持水平扩展,即通过增加节点来提高系统的处理能力,这种扩展方式具有较好的灵活性,可以根据业务需求动态调整节点数量,实现系统的弹性扩展。

4、成本效益

相较于传统的大型数据库系统,MySQL分布式架构具有更高的性价比,它采用开源技术,降低了企业的硬件和软件成本,分布式架构还可以充分利用现有的硬件资源,提高资源利用率。

MySQL分布式架构的实践

1、数据分片

数据分片是将整个数据集分散存储到多个节点上的过程,常见的分片策略有范围分片、哈希分片和列表分片等,在实际应用中,可以根据业务需求和数据特点选择合适的分片策略。

2、负载均衡

负载均衡是将请求分散到多个节点上的过程,以实现节点之间的负载均衡,常见的负载均衡策略有轮询、最少连接数和响应时间等,在实际应用中,可以根据业务场景选择合适的负载均衡策略。

3、故障转移和恢复

故障转移是指当某个节点发生故障时,自动将请求转移到其他正常节点上,故障恢复是指在故障节点修复后,自动将数据同步到该节点上,在实际应用中,可以通过数据库复制、日志同步等技术实现故障转移和恢复。

4、数据一致性

在分布式架构中,数据一致性是指多个节点上的数据保持一致,常见的数据一致性策略有强一致性、最终一致性和用户自定义一致性等,在实际应用中,可以根据业务需求选择合适的数据一致性策略。

5、监控与运维

监控与运维是保证分布式数据库系统正常运行的关键,在实际应用中,可以通过以下方式实现:

(1)监控系统资源使用情况,如CPU、内存、磁盘等;

(2)监控数据库性能,如查询响应时间、事务处理速度等;

(3)监控网络状况,如延迟、丢包等;

(4)定期检查系统日志,分析故障原因;

(5)定期对系统进行优化和调整。

MySQL分布式架构作为一种高效的数据管理和处理方案,具有高可用性、高性能、可扩展性和成本效益等优势,在实际应用中,通过数据分片、负载均衡、故障转移和恢复、数据一致性以及监控与运维等实践,可以充分发挥分布式架构的优势,为企业提供稳定、高效的数据服务。

以下是50个中文相关关键词:

MySQL分布式, 数据库分布式, 分布式架构, 高可用性, 高性能, 可扩展性, 成本效益, 数据分片, 负载均衡, 故障转移, 故障恢复, 数据一致性, 监控, 运维, 开源技术, 资源利用率, 范围分片, 哈希分片, 列表分片, 轮询, 最少连接数, 响应时间, 数据库复制, 日志同步, 强一致性, 最终一致性, 用户自定义一致性, 系统资源, CPU, 内存, 磁盘, 数据库性能, 查询响应时间, 事务处理速度, 网络状况, 延迟, 丢包, 系统日志, 故障原因, 系统优化, 系统调整, 业务需求, 数据管理, 数据处理, 数据服务, 数据存储, 数据冗余

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L分布式:mysql分布式架构

原文链接:,转发请注明来源!